Step 4: Leaked descriptor audit. Before migrating Harbell's queue workers to the new runtime, confirm no file descriptors leak across fork boundaries. Run the soak harness for two hours and compare open-handle counts against the baseline snapshot. Anything above a delta of five means the old pooling shim is still loaded. The values below reflect the post-migration service configuration.

deployment values, yadug-bawif:
[framir]
team = pelox
access_code = ac_a38ab2
owner = tamion.julael
host = framir.tolvaqlabs.test
port = 11211
peer = tammir.zemvargrid.local
salt = 2215ef03
pin = 1541

**Runbook — Account Recovery: HaulMetric Fuel Report API**

Plugin authors: if your service account is locked after failed pulls of the fleet fuel-usage report, do not re-register. Open a recovery request via the HaulMetric partner portal, reference your plugin slug, and wait for the unlock confirmation. Retry the report endpoint only after the lock clears. If the portal itself is unreachable, authenticate at the fallback console using the recovery passphrase below.

unlock words, yawig-kagef: gordor-holvan-ulaael-pramir-ulaiel-tamdor

Handing over the Stockfold reconciliation job. It runs nightly at 02:00 and compares warehouse counts against the ledger; small drifts are auto-corrected, anything over fifty units opens a review task. Watch the Tuesday runs — supplier feeds often arrive late. Full failure modes, rerun steps, and contact rotations are documented on the internal page.

operations page: https://jenkins.zemvarcloud.local/job/merge_requests/repo/build/73930b4b30f0a8ed